Relationship among entity-entity class-entity instance
Describe the relationship among entity, entity class, and entity instance.
Expert
An entity is something which can be identified in the users' work environment, something which the users desire to track. Entities of a given kind are grouped into entity classes. An entity instance is the presentation of a specific entity.
